8. Set up Complexity
The set up of an Android Auto double DIN head unit typically presents a major problem, instantly impacting the person expertise and total worth proposition. As a result of standardized double DIN type issue, these models are designed to exchange present automobile radios. Nevertheless, the complexity arises from {the electrical} connections, car integration, and bodily fitment. Profitable set up necessitates a radical understanding of automotive electrical methods, vehicle-specific wiring harnesses, and potential compatibility points. A mismatched wiring harness or incorrect connection can result in system malfunctions, car harm, and even security hazards. As an illustration, improper wiring of the facility provide might lead to a blown fuse or harm to the top unit itself, necessitating skilled restore or alternative.
Moreover, fashionable automobiles typically combine the manufacturing facility radio with different important methods, similar to local weather management, car settings, and security options. Changing the manufacturing facility radio with an aftermarket Android Auto double DIN unit requires cautious consideration of those integrations. In some instances, specialised interface modules are essential to retain performance of those methods. An instance consists of automobiles the place the manufacturing facility radio controls the air-con; changing it with out the right interface module would render the air-con system inoperable. Moreover, the bodily set up could require modifications to the car’s dashboard or console to accommodate the brand new unit, additional rising the complexity. Skilled set up typically turns into mandatory to make sure correct integration and keep away from potential harm to the car’s electrical system.

9. Audio High quality
Audio high quality represents a important aspect throughout the person expertise of an Android Auto double DIN head unit. The core operate of a automobile radio, no matter its technological developments, stays audio playback. Subsequently, the constancy of the audio replica instantly influences the perceived worth and satisfaction derived from the system. A high-quality audio sign chain, encompassing digital-to-analog conversion (DAC), amplification, and speaker output, is crucial for optimum efficiency. As an illustration, a double DIN unit boasting superior options like navigation and smartphone integration turns into considerably much less interesting if the audio output is characterised by distortion, restricted dynamic vary, or a poor signal-to-noise ratio. The Android Auto platform itself depends on the top unit’s audio capabilities to ship clear voice prompts, intelligible telephone calls, and immersive music playback.
A number of elements contribute to the audio high quality of an Android Auto double DIN unit. The standard of the inner DAC instantly impacts the accuracy of audio replica from digital sources, similar to streaming providers or USB drives. The built-in amplifier determines the facility and readability of the audio sign despatched to the car’s audio system. Moreover, the unit’s potential to assist numerous audio codecs (e.g., FLAC, MP3, AAC) and equalization settings permits customers to customise the sound to their preferences and compensate for deficiencies within the car’s acoustics. For instance, a person with a high-resolution audio library would profit from a unit able to taking part in lossless audio codecs, whereas one other person may prioritize the unit’s equalization settings to fine-tune the sound for various genres of music. Compatibility with exterior amplifiers and subwoofers additional enhances audio high quality and permits for extra personalized audio setups.

Ideas for Optimizing an Android Auto Double DIN System
This part gives actionable recommendation to maximise the efficiency and longevity of an Android Auto double DIN head unit.
Tip 1: Recurrently Replace Firmware. Protecting the top unit’s firmware present is essential. Producers launch updates that tackle bugs, enhance efficiency, and improve compatibility with newer smartphones and apps. Verify the producer’s web site for firmware updates and comply with the prescribed set up procedures meticulously.
Tip 2: Make the most of Excessive-High quality Cables. For wired Android Auto connections, make use of an authorized, high-quality USB cable. Inferior cables could cause intermittent disconnections, gradual information switch charges, and charging points. Confirm the cable helps information switch along with energy supply.
Tip 3: Optimize Smartphone Settings. Android Auto efficiency is reliant on the linked smartphone. Make sure the smartphone’s working system is updated, background app exercise is minimized, and pointless location providers are disabled. These changes can enhance responsiveness and scale back information consumption.
Tip 4: Safe Bodily Connections. Periodically examine the wiring connections behind the top unit. Vibration and temperature fluctuations can loosen connections over time. Guarantee all wiring harnesses are securely mounted and correctly insulated to forestall shorts or intermittent failures.
Tip 5: Handle App Permissions. Overview the permissions granted to the Android Auto software on the smartphone. Prohibit entry to pointless permissions to reinforce privateness and safety. Solely grant permissions which might be instantly associated to the app’s performance inside Android Auto.
Tip 6: Defend the Touchscreen. Make use of a display screen protector to protect towards scratches and smudges. Clear the touchscreen usually with a microfiber fabric and a non-abrasive display screen cleaner. Keep away from utilizing extreme pressure when interacting with the touchscreen.
Tip 7: Monitor System Temperature. Extreme warmth can degrade the efficiency and lifespan of digital parts. Guarantee ample air flow across the head unit. Keep away from extended publicity to direct daylight and think about putting in a small cooling fan if the unit is susceptible to overheating.
